I see it as having a positive affect , you have added a quality rider to the NL , if he's eligable no problems. Robert wouldn't have been able to ride for Rye without flying , and I think it was actually cheaper to fly than pay mileage. I was a bit sceptical it would work but he only missed one meeting that he could have ridden and that was more because he had to drive to bring his bikes home as he had a meeting the next day, it took some organising at times and he relied on pick up and drop offs at airports but it seemed to work. As far as we are aware there is no reason Robert cant do all leagues, initially he asked not to be on the list as he felt his priority needed to be to establish himself in the premier league and had agreed to ride for Edinburgh. He than asked to be placed on the reserves list earlier in the season , and has since asked to be included on the list as a permanent replacement if a position came up.As he has never had a PL average over 4, hes ok which i think stops others riders. All good Banter on here from the supporters. On a serious safety note the reason Robert returning to the pits was because he noticed his fuel cap was missing. Surely there has to be give and take in the rule as to ride without a cap is a serious safety issue with fuel splashing over everything including the rider. Was there not a clerk of the course that could have relayed this to the referee. Chopper
